Abstract | PROBLEM TO BE SOLVED: To obtain a liquid radiation-curable resin composition which has a low viscosity, a high refractive index and a good curability by irradiation of a low energetic radiation and gives a cured coating having a low Young's modulus, a large elongation and an excellent characteristic as a primary coating material for optical fibers, and to obtain a coating composition for an optical fiber, and to provide the optical fiber. SOLUTION: The liquid radiation-curable resin composition comprises (A) 100 pts.wt of a urethane (meth)acrylate oligomer having in the molecule a skeleton expressed by formulae (1) and/or (2) (wherein, (a), (b) and (c) are each an integer satisfying 10≤a≤40, 20≤b≤60, 10≤c≤40; and (d), (e) and (f) are each an integer satisfying 10≤d≤40, 20≤e≤70 and 10≤f≤40), (B) 5-200 pts.wt. of an ethylenically unsaturated compound and (C) 0-20 pts.wt. of a photopolymerization initiator.
